What LED light contributes to peroxide whitening
Every modern-day in-office whitening system relies on a peroxide gel, usually hydrogen peroxide in between about 25 and 40 percent, or carbamide peroxide at a proportionally greater percentage. Peroxide diffuses into enamel and dentin, then breaks down into reactive oxygen species that interrupt pigmented molecules. That oxidation is the chemistry behind shade modification whether light is utilized or not.
LEDs enter as a driver, not a lightening agent. A blue LED, normally in the 430 to 490 nanometer range, can do two helpful things. First, it can provide mild, regulated heat that raises the gel temperature by a few degrees. Warmer gels break down much faster, which can cut the time needed per application. Second, some gel solutions include light-sensitive activators that respond particularly to blue wavelengths, increasing the rate of peroxide decomposition in a targeted way.
Where patients sometimes get misled remains in presuming light equals more white. The literature is mixed. When you control for gel strength and application time, the outright shade gain from an LED may be modest for some smiles. In my chair, LED use tends to make results more foreseeable within a repaired visit window. On a practical level, that implies the difference in between ending a session with a borderline shade change or getting another gel cycle in comfortably.
Notably, LED systems utilized in expert settings do not produce ultraviolet light. The blue output you see is visible light. Heat is low, and with cheek retractors, gingival barriers, and eye protection, the process remains comfortable for the majority of patients.
LED whitening is not laser whitening
Patients in some cases call it laser teeth whitening in Gilbert, however the light source in nearly all cosmetic teeth whitening Gilbert offices is LED, not laser. Lasers produce meaningful light with firmly focused power. LEDs produce non-coherent light with broad illumination and low heat. The LED benefit is protection and gentleness. You can bathe the whole arch evenly without danger of a hot spot.

Where LED systems shine, and where they do not
Surface staining from coffee, tea, red white wine, tobacco, and spicy sauces responds magnificently to peroxide, and the LED tends to speed up these cases. Someone who drinks 2 lattes a day and has not had a professional cleaning in a year will typically show a 3 to five shade bump in a single see as soon as plaque and calculus are removed.
Mature intrinsic staining is various. Tetracycline staining, fluorosis, or deep gray bands from enduring practices might lighten, however they normally require more time, supplemental take-home trays, or both. LED assistance still assists, yet the law of decreasing returns uses. Whitening likewise has limits with remediations. Porcelain veneers and ceramic crowns will not alter color, and composite fillings will not lighten meaningfully. If you prepare to bleach before replacing front fillings, do the whitening initially, let the shade support for about 2 weeks, then match new restorations to the more vibrant baseline.

The appointment, start to finish
Lighting up a smile safely is a workflow more than a gizmo trick. A well-paced, thoughtful sequence makes the distinction between a brilliant jump and a blotchy outcome or a sensitivity flare. - Pre-whitening evaluation: your dentist charts existing restorations, checks for cracks, economic crisis, or leaky fillings, and confirms you are not pregnant or nursing. If you have active decay or gum inflammation, these get dealt with first. Cleaning and prep: shallow stain and plaque are polished away. An isolated, clean surface area lets peroxide contact enamel uniformly. If you have heavy calculus, a different hygiene see might be scheduled before whitening. Isolation and defense: cheek retractors, cotton rolls, and a light-cured gingival barrier keep gel off your lips and gums. Eyes get shielded throughout LED usage. This action is dull however essential for comfort. Gel application with LED cycles: the peroxide gel goes on in a thin, consistent layer. The LED light activates for a set time, frequently 10 to 15 minutes, per cycle. Depending upon your starting shade and level of sensitivity, 2 to 4 cycles are normal. The gel is refreshed in between rounds. Desensitizing and completing: after the last cycle, the gel is eliminated entirely. A fluoride or potassium nitrate paste calms the nerves inside your teeth. You rinse, compare tones, and evaluation aftercare.
Does LED make it discomfort totally free, or a minimum of tolerable?
True discomfort throughout whitening is rare in a controlled setting. Sensitivity, specifically to cold air, prevails. The LED does not cause sensitivity by itself, but accelerating peroxide breakdown can periodically stir the fluid in your dentinal tubules a bit more quickly. For those with a history of sensitivity, I motivate a week of desensitizing tooth paste, early morning and night, and we might step down gel strength a notch while adding one extra cycle. This tends to land at the same final shade with fewer jolts.

The security profile of blue LEDs
Blue LEDs have actually been used in dentistry for years to cure fillings, sanitize root canals, and illuminate dark corners during treatments. For whitening, we utilize them at low energy levels. The light shows up, not UV, so it does not position the skin risks connected with tanning booths. Eye defense stays on because brilliant blue light can cause glare and fatigue.
Gum defense matters more than the light. A well-placed gingival barrier avoids peroxide contact with soft tissue, and any small gel seepage is suctioned away rapidly. If you get a white, milky spot on your gum after a lapse in seclusion, it normally deals with within a day with saline rinses and vitamin E oil. How much shade change to anticipate, really
Shade guides are divided into tabs that represent small actions in brightness and chroma. Most healthy grownups see a three to 8 tab enhancement during a very first in-office session. Beginning shade, enamel density, and stain type drive variation. Someone with thick, naturally yellow enamel may top out at a natural, warm white rather than movie-screen white. A thinner enamel patient can look brilliant rapidly, but also requires more careful level of sensitivity management.
It deserves pointing out rebound. The day after whitening, dehydrated enamel can look slightly whiter. As your teeth rehydrate, the shade can relax by about half a tab. This is normal. A two-week check can validate your stable shade, and if you plan brand-new front fillings or cosmetic bonding, that is the time to color match.

Who is a perfect prospect, and who ought to wait
Healthy adults with no untreated cavities or gum illness are ideal. If you have active orthodontic treatment, we hold whitening up until after brackets are off, though some tray-based options can brighten available surface areas. Pregnant or nursing patients should hold off. If you have a lot of visible composite fillings, whitening initially can make them more obvious. Plan for replacement if the color mismatch bothers you.
For heavy smokers or those with deep brown stain bands, we sometimes phase care. Initially, a comprehensive health appointment to separate calculus. Second, a brief in-office LED session to lift the standard. Third, 2 to 3 weeks of take-home trays to level tone. This series handles the blotchy look that can happen when surface area spots raise faster than much deeper pigments.
Patients inquiring about natural teeth whitening Gilbert concepts, like lemon, charcoal, or baking soda, need to know these can wear down enamel or abrade away luster. Enamel is finite. Once you thin it, light reflects in a different way and teeth can look more yellow, not less. If you desire a mild home increase, a carbamide peroxide gel in customized trays is both safer and more efficient than pantry hacks.

What to anticipate in convenience and schedule after your appointment
Many clients return to work right after in-office whitening. Your teeth might feel a little zingy when you breathe in cool air or sip water for 24 to 48 hours. A warm, not hot, diet and space temperature level beverages tame that. Prevent strongly colored sauces, beets, turmeric, red white wine, and dark berries for the first day if you can. The short-lived dehydration of enamel makes it a bit more absorbent instantly after care.
If you plan pictures, schedule whitening a minimum of a week before the occasion. That gives you time for shade stabilization and a fast check see if needed. Results that last, and how to preserve them
With daily habits, an in-office LED whitening result typically holds for 6 to 18 months. Heavy coffee or red wine consumption pushes you to the much shorter end of that variety. Light coffee drinkers who wash after meals and use a mild touch when brushing often stay intense longer. Quick monthly touch-ups with a low strength gel in custom-made trays can extend periods between complete in-office sessions.
